Mr. Emery was an important person in my life. He was my Troop 610 Scoutmaster in the late 1970's. He is the reason why I have a love of the outdoors. He lead many scouts on backpack trips in the local Deserts and the Sierra Nevada Mts. I have wonderful memories of summer camp at Mataguay Scout Reservation, we would camp for a week and have to cook, clean and take care of ourselves. Mr Emery at the time had more than 60 kids under his charge and he excelled at keeping us in line as well as teaching us how to become men.
Mr. Emery is a true Hero to me and many others. God Bless you Mr. Emery!!
Grant Usell, Poway Ca.
